, Statis Discharge Reel - Answer-Must be discharged when working with 20mm, 75 foot
cord to discharge the UALS

University Ammunition Loading System (UALS) - Answer-transports 20mm to and from
aircraft and into aircraft gun system

Pneumatic System - Answer-2 gas cylinder w/ 3000 PSI

2100 - Answer-How many rounds can fit in the outer drum of the UALS?

Interface Unit - Answer-mechanical connection between the replinesher or the aircraft
and the UALS

60+/-35psi - Answer-What is the safety air pressure on the UALS?

LALS - Answer-Loading system with interface unit and pneumatic system

30mm - Answer-Primarily used by A-10s against tanks and armored vehicles

aluminum - Answer-What is the cartridge case of 30mm made out of?

API - Answer-Special penetrator 30mm round with depleted uranium inside hollow
aluminum windscreen

Dummy Round - Answer-30mm bronze projectile with black markings

M548 - Answer-Container that holds 36 rounds of bulk 30mm

CNU300 Container - Answer-holds 575 linked rounds 30mm, used to load GAU 8

GFU-7 - Answer-processes 30mm ammo and uploads/downloads A-10 aircraft

Aircraft Hydraulic System - Answer-What powers the GFU-7?

Steel - Answer-What kind of cartridge is 25mm?

HEI - Answer-Yellow with red band 25mm

dummy rounds - Answer-used for load crew certification and training as well as
familiziartion

CNU-405 - Answer-25mm is packaged in 80-100 rounds in this container

MK-1 - Answer-16 rounds of 40 mm is stored in this

116 pounds - Answer-How much does the mk1 weigh full?
